OpenBet has deepened its partnership with Finland’s state-owned gambling operator Veikkaus through the deployment of Neccton’s AI-enhanced responsible gambling technology.

The agreement, reported by iGamingBusiness on 16 June 2026, will see Veikkaus use Neccton’s player protection platform across both digital and retail channels. The system is designed to provide real-time behavioural monitoring and automated interventions where player activity indicates potential risk.

The move comes as Finland prepares for a major restructuring of its gambling market. Under the country’s new Gambling Act, Veikkaus’ monopoly over betting, online slot games, online casino games and online bingo is due to end, with licensed gambling services able to begin from 1 July 2027.

Wider Role For Neccton Technology

Neccton forms part of OpenBet’s player protection and compliance offering. OpenBet describes the technology as covering responsible gambling, anti-money laundering and fraud detection, with monitoring tools intended to help operators identify risky gambling behaviour and support earlier interventions.

OpenBet acquired Neccton in 2023, positioning the business as a core part of its responsible gambling capabilities. At the time, OpenBet said the acquisition brought together sports betting technology with cloud and AI-led tools for player protection, operator compliance and regulatory support.

For Veikkaus, the expanded use of Neccton adds another compliance and safer gambling layer ahead of a more competitive Finnish market. The Finnish Ministry of the Interior has said the country’s gambling reform is intended to reduce gambling-related harm and improve the channelling of gambling activity towards regulated services.

Finland Prepares For Market Reform

Finland has historically operated under a monopoly model, with Veikkaus as the state-owned gambling operator. The reform will retain a partial monopoly for some products, including lottery-type games, scratch cards, physical slot machines and casino games, while opening several online verticals to licensed competition.

The Finnish Government confirmed in January 2026 that most provisions of the new Gambling Act will enter into force on 1 July 2027. Until the end of June 2027, Veikkaus remains the monopoly operator under the supervision of the National Police Board.

That timetable gives Veikkaus just over a year to prepare for a market in which international operators are expected to compete for licensed online betting and casino customers. The addition of enhanced monitoring tools suggests safer gambling and compliance will remain central to the operator’s preparation for the transition.

Responsible Gambling Focus

The OpenBet and Veikkaus development is notable because it links platform transformation with harm-prevention technology rather than focusing only on product expansion.

For UK readers, the story is also relevant in the context of wider European regulatory trends. Regulators and state-backed operators are increasingly looking at how behavioural data, affordability signals and automated interventions can support safer gambling requirements.

The Finnish reform will be watched closely by operators, suppliers and regulators because it combines market liberalisation with a stated public policy aim of reducing gambling harm. The Veikkaus deployment gives OpenBet a broader role in that transition, extending its work with the operator beyond sportsbook transformation and into player protection infrastructure.
